If you're a light data user you should check out ting. They use Sprints network and their price structure is really cool. There is no set plan, everyone's minutes, texts, and data is pooled together and you get charged for whatever you use. If you need the latest and greatest phone thought this probably won't work since their agreement with Sprint only allows them to activate phones that have been out for a year. So you can't use a Galaxy s4 yet on ting.
